LG Q70 is slightly better than Moto Z2 Play, getting a 77.9 score against 77.4. Although the LG Q70 is notably newer than the Moto Z2 Play, it is much heavier and way thicker. The Moto Z2 Play and LG Q70 feature very similar displays, because although the Moto Z2 Play has a bit smaller screen and a bit worse resolution of 1080 x 1920, it also counts with a just a little better pixel quantity per inch in the display.
LG Q70 and Motorola Moto Z2 Play both count with extremely similar memory capacity to store more games and applications, they have an external memory card slot that holds a maximum of 1,95 TB and the same 64 GB internal storage. Motorola Moto Z2 Play has just a little better performance than LG Q70. They have 8 cpu cores and a 4 GB RAM.
LG Q70 counts with better battery life than Moto Z2 Play, because it has 4000mAh of battery capacity. The LG Q70 captures much better photos and videos than Moto Z2 Play, because although it has a tinier aperture which is not recommended for low light photos, and they both have the same 30 frames per second video frame rates and the same 3840x2160 (4K) video definition, the LG Q70 also counts with a much better resolution camera in the back.
Although LG Q70 is a better device, it is way more expensive than the Moto Z2 Play, and it doesn't have such a good quality/price relation as the Moto Z2 Play. So if you need that extra specs and features, you can buy the LG Q70, but if you don't you can save a couple dollars and buy the Moto Z2 Play, giving up a couple features and specifications.
